• Do not place feet or hands near
or under rotating parts. Do not
stand in front of the grass ejec-
tion hole during sickle mowing.
• If the lawnmower starts to vib-
rate abnormally, an immediate
check must be carried out.
- search for signs of damage;
- have any necessary repairs
carried out on damaged
parts;
- make sure that all nuts, bolts
and screws are properly
tightened.
Maintenance and Storage:
When servicing the blades,
remember that they can
move even if the power
source is off.
• Ensure that all nuts, bolts and
screws are tightened firmly and
the equipment is in safe work-
ing condition.
• Check the mower for any dam-
ages.
• Repair damaged parts as ap-
propriate.
• Do not attempt to repair the
equipment yourself unless you
68
have been trained to do so.
Any work not specified in these
instructions is to be carried out
only by customer service cen-
tres that we have authorised.
• Keep the equipment in a dry
location and out of reach of
children.
• Handle the equipment with
care. Keep tools sharp and
clean, in order to facilitate bet-
ter and safer work. Follow the
maintenance instructions.
• Wear protective gloves when
changing the cutting device.
• Regularly check the grass col-
lection device for wear and
strains. For safety reasons, re-
place worn or damaged parts.
When adjusting the blades,
take particular care to avoid
fingers being trapped between
the rotating blades and fixed
parts of the machine.
• Check that only replacement
tools authorised by the manu-
facturer are used.
• Take care with equipment that
has several cutting tools, as
the movement of one blade
may result in the rotation of the
other blades.
Electrical Safety:
• Ensure that the mains voltage
matches the specifications on
the rating plate.
• Connect the equipment to a
socked with a RCD (Residual
Current Device) with a release
current of more than 30 mA.
• Avoid bodily contact with
earthed parts (e.g. metal fenc-
es, metal posts).
